25. BioShock Infinite
A narrative masterpiece, BioShock Infinite immerses players in Columbia, a floating city filled with political intrigue and rich storytelling. Combat blends guns, vigors, and strategic movement, while the story explores complex themes of identity, choice, and morality. Its breathtaking visuals and engaging characters cement its place as a 2013 classic.

23. Assassin’s Creed IV: Black Flag
Set in the Golden Age of Piracy, this open-world adventure blends naval combat, stealth, and exploration. Players assume Edward Kenway’s role as a pirate navigating the Caribbean. Its dynamic ship battles, immersive world, and engaging story offer a fresh take on the Assassin’s Creed franchise.
22. Super Mario 3D World
Super Mario 3D World is a vibrant, inventive platformer that blends classic Mario mechanics with creative 3D level design. Players can choose from Mario, Luigi, Peach, and Toad, each with unique abilities, as they race through imaginative worlds, collect power-ups, and defeat enemies. Multiplayer adds cooperative chaos, while clever level design, secret paths, and dynamic challenges keep the experience fresh. Its charm, polish, and replayability make it one of the most joyful Mario adventures in years.

17. Warframe
Free-to-play cooperative shooter with fast-paced parkour, fluid combat, and extensive customization. Players control Tenno warriors completing missions across planets. Its progression system, mod mechanics, and cooperative gameplay helped it grow into a massive ongoing franchise.
16. State of Decay
An open-world zombie survival game that blends base-building, scavenging, and character management. Players must maintain morale, supplies, and survivors while exploring a dangerous world. Its emergent gameplay and tension-filled encounters make survival a constant challenge.
15. Metro: Last Light
A post-apocalyptic shooter with survival horror elements, Metro: Last Light combines atmospheric storytelling, tense combat, and resource management. Players navigate tunnels and hostile surface zones, balancing stealth and firepower to survive, delivering an immersive and haunting experience.
